An old flamenco juan estruch guitar of the mid 70’s is presently for sale in a guitar shop near Rambla.
Price is 680 e, sounds well but not in a perfect condition ( but look rather nice anyway). Similar model seen in Paris last year, looking like new, for sale at 1000 euros. the original receipt of the 1st sale in 1974 was, in pesetas, an amount that, given inflation and interest rates since 1974, would give more or less the same price. So, estimation is, according the sound and the condution of the guitar and the country of location – cheaper in Spain of course – between 600 and 1000 euros.

– YES! I bought a very short scale 12 string from the Estruch factory-shop in Barcelona in 1970. While doing some research I saw your posting. I’m selling mine on eBay and I was trying to see if they still make them, get a current price, etc. It seems that Estruch is only making standard Flamenco and classical models now, but he used to make all manner of folk instruments. It’s a curious piece, no? Good woods, mediocre craftsmenship, good sound. I played it in a 70’s garage blues band using a slide! Please send me a photo so I can see if mine matches yours.
